Output 85431f260594a576b2a5b78f18176ad9c459fe2ba4f38e5e674f47e647bb9af2:1

value
1020742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b91fce30727d52de0b166690d467939db2f32a OP_EQUAL
address
33wjuofXbf1HKPdU4xMx9VdtwM6UaX9X2E
transaction
85431f260594a576b2a5b78f18176ad9c459fe2ba4f38e5e674f47e647bb9af2
spent
true